    Parents and guardians have been urged to stop hiding or neglecting children with disabilities and instead give them a chance at education, dignity, and growth. This renewed call for action comes as the Rotary Club of Kirinyaga, under the leadership of President Winfred Muthoni Ndambirii, officially handed over a fully renovated and equipped special needs classroom at Gakuu Comprehensive School in Kirinyaga County. The move marks a significant milestone in the journey toward inclusive education in rural areas, where access to proper learning facilities for children with disabilities remains limited. “Many children with special needs are kept out of school due to stigma, misinformation, and the lack of a conducive learning environment. These children deserve an equal opportunity to learn and thrive. Our mission is to ensure no child is left behind because of a disability,” says Ndambiri
